Output fa8036673760f9f5814195d1906c7fee6a715bc80f3e0de67848b10cce011f89:3

value
4134658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1ddbdcbd033036ae07334d996d61b92ba61123 OP_EQUAL
address
3BdyM5grwVWNPvtotXvW9H2DtNUdQZYYd2
transaction
fa8036673760f9f5814195d1906c7fee6a715bc80f3e0de67848b10cce011f89
spent
true